Submitted by Karen Mannix
19 students from Talkeetna Elementary School competed at the Mat Su School District Elementary Cross Country Championships on Wednesday. The weather cooperated so runners were able to compete on dry, forested trails at Palmer High School. Beautiful autumn colors and moderate temperatures contributed to a quality experience for everyone. The team was lead by 4th grader, Maya Mossanen, who had the best individual place finish of the team in her mile and a half race.
All runners enjoyed the races, by cheering on their teammates and running their best. Coach Mannix would like to congratulate her team for showing tremendous sportsmanship and effort. Thanks to parents for all the support during the season and on race day.
